The Problem of Lead in Spices

Lead contamination in food, including spices, poses a serious public health concern, particularly for vulnerable populations like children. Unlike lead-based paint, which was banned decades ago, there are no federal limits for lead in spices in the U.S., though some states like New York have implemented their own. Contamination can occur in several ways, and distinguishing between naturally occurring trace amounts and deliberate adulteration is key to understanding the risk.

Sources of Contamination

Lead can find its way into spices through several avenues:

  • Soil Contamination: Spices are grown in soil, which can contain lead from industrial pollution, mining, or aging infrastructure. The plants can absorb these heavy metals, which then become concentrated during the drying process.
  • Intentional Adulteration: In some regions with less stringent regulations, vendors may intentionally add lead-based compounds to spices to enhance their appearance or increase their weight. For example, lead chromate is a yellow pigment added to turmeric to make it appear more vibrant.
  • Processing and Handling: Contamination can also happen during processing if machinery or storage containers contain lead. This is a particular risk for loose or unbranded spices that may lack quality control standards.

What Spices Contain Lead? A closer look at the highest risks

Recent studies and recalls have highlighted specific spices that carry a higher risk of lead contamination, often due to their vibrant colors or unregulated sourcing.

Turmeric and Lead

Turmeric, prized for its golden-yellow color, is one of the most frequently cited spices with dangerously high lead levels due to intentional adulteration.

  • Intentional Pigments: Investigations in South Asia, particularly in regions like Patna, India, and Karachi, Pakistan, have found widespread use of lead chromate to intensify the spice's color.
  • Case Studies: A 2018 North Carolina study linked spices, including turmeric with 890 ppm of lead, to cases of childhood lead poisoning.

Cinnamon and Lead

Cinnamon has been the subject of numerous recalls, demonstrating a persistent problem with contamination.

  • Recalls and Findings: In September 2024, Consumer Reports published findings showing high lead levels in 12 popular ground cinnamon and spice blends. This followed earlier FDA warnings and recalls of cinnamon products.
  • Long-term Absorption: The longer a cinnamon tree grows, the more time it has to absorb trace amounts of lead from the soil, which becomes more concentrated during processing.

Other Spices to Watch

While not as consistently high-risk as turmeric or cinnamon, several other spices warrant caution, especially if sourced from less-regulated markets.

  • Chili Powder and Paprika: The vibrant red color of these spices makes them a target for color-enhancing adulterants.
  • Coriander and Cumin: These spices have also shown detectable lead levels in various studies, often linked to environmental absorption.
  • Spice Blends: Complex spice mixtures like curry powder, five-spice powder, and garam masala can contain multiple contaminated ingredients, compounding the risk.

Protecting Your Nutrition Diet from Lead Exposure

Reducing your exposure to lead in spices is crucial for maintaining a healthy diet. This requires a proactive approach to sourcing and consumption habits.

Practical Prevention Tips:

  • Favor Reputable Brands: Stick to well-known, reputable spice brands that are subject to stricter quality control and testing, such as those sold in mainstream U.S. grocery stores. Consumer Reports tests have identified some brands with very low or undetectable lead levels.
  • Avoid Imported, Unpackaged Spices: Spices purchased abroad, particularly in bulk, unmarked bags, or from street markets, carry a significantly higher risk of contamination due to less rigorous oversight.
  • Diversify Your Diet: Varying your spices and food sources can help minimize the risk of overexposure from a single contaminated product.
  • Grow Your Own Herbs: For certain herbs like thyme and oregano, growing them yourself can prevent heavy metal accumulation from pesticides, fertilizers, and polluted environments.

What to Do If You Suspect Contamination

If you have concerns about the safety of your spices, especially older, unlabeled, or imported items, it's best to act with caution. Always dispose of any products included in official recall notices.

  • Avoid Home Testing: Do not rely on home-based lead test kits designed for surfaces. These are not accurate for determining the presence or concentration of lead in spices.
  • Laboratory Testing: The only reliable way to confirm lead contamination in a spice is through laboratory testing.
  • Consult a Healthcare Provider: If you or a family member suspects exposure, contact a healthcare provider for a blood lead test. Many people with low-level lead exposure show no immediate symptoms.
